Model 230.25

Bourdon Tube Pressure Gauges

Ultra High Purity (UHP) Series

Applications

  • Semiconductor and electronic industry, medical industry, gene technology, biotechnology and pharmaceutical industries.

  • Suitable for corrosive environments and gaseous or liquid media that will not obstruct the pressure system

  • Where measurement of high purity gases is needed without contamination of the process media.


Special Features

  • 316L SS and 316L SS VIM/VAR wetted parts

  • Electropolished SS case, socket & face-seal connection

  • Positive and compound pressure ranges to 5000 psi


Standard Features

Design
ASME B40.100

Sizes
2" (50 mm) 1 ½" (40 mm)

Accuracy Class
2": ± 2/1/2% of span (ASME B40.100 Grade A)
1 ½": ± 3/2/3% of span (ASME B40.100 Grade B)

Ranges
Vacuum / compound to 30"Hg/0/300 psi
Pressure from 15 psi up to 5000 psi or other equivalent units of pressure or vacuum

Working Pressure
Steady: ¾ full-scale value
Fluctuating: 2/3 full-scale value
Short time: full-scale value

Operating Temperature
Ambient: -40°F to +140°F (-40°C to +60°C)
Medium: +212°F (+100°C) maximum

Temperature Error
Additional error when temperature changes from reference temperature of 68°F (20°C) ±0.4% for every 18°F (10°C) rising or falling. Percentage of span.

Weather Protection
Weather resistant (NEMA 3 / IP 54)

Pressure Connection
Material: Face-seal nut, 316 SS
               Face-seal gland, 316L SS VOD or VIM/VAR
Position: Lower mount (LM)
               Center back mount (CBM)
Type of Connection: Face-seal fixed male, swivel male or female
Wetted Surface Finish: Ra < 0.25μm (Ra < 10μinch)

Bourdon Tube
Material: 316L SS
30”Hg (vac) to 1,000 psi, C-type
1,500 to 5,000 psi, helical type
Helium leak tested 1 x 10-9 scc/sec (inboard)

Socket
Material: 316L VIM/VAR electropolished
               Ra < 0.25μm (Ra < 10μinch) - internal

Movement
Stainless steel

Dial
White aluminum with stop pin and black lettering

Pointer
Black aluminum

Case
304 SS, electropolished

Window
Polycarbonate: twist-lock (2"), snap cap (1½")
